MONTREAL – A house party was broken up in Brossard early Thursday morning.
The party came to a screeching halt at 3:20 am, as police received information that there was an armed man in the apartment on Davignon St.

They ended up finding a pellet gun.
Three young partygoers, all in their early 20’s, were taken to police headquarters to be questioned.
Charges have not been pressed as of yet.
